Chief Investment Officer (CIO) - Dubai International Financial Centre (DIFC), Dubai

We are seeking an experienced Chief Investment Officer (CIO) to lead the investment strategy for a growing Dubai-based investment management firm headquartered in DIFC.

This is a senior leadership role responsible for overseeing the firm's investment strategy, asset allocation framework, and portfolio construction across multi-asset portfolios. The successful candidate will bring deep experience across global markets and a strong track record in strategic asset allocation and investment leadership.

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ead the firm's investment strategy and asset allocation framework across all portfolios.
  • Oversee multi-asset portfolio construction, including equities, fixed income, alternatives, private markets, and other asset classes.
  • Chair or lead the Investment Committee, providing strategic guidance on market outlook, portfolio positioning, and risk management.
  • Develop and implement long-term asset allocation strategies aligned with client objectives.
  • Manage and mentor the investment team, fostering a culture of disciplined investment decision-making.
  • Monitor global macroeconomic trends and translate insights into actionable portfolio strategies.
  • Engage with key stakeholders including clients, board members, and senior management.
  • Ensure all investment activities comply with DIFC regulatory requirements and internal governance frameworks.

Candidate Profile

  • Applicants must already be based in Dubai.
  • Strong academic credentials in finance, economics, or a related discipline (CFA or equivalent preferred).
  • Extensive experience in asset allocation across multiple asset classes, including equities, fixed income, alternatives, and private markets.
  • Proven track record in portfolio construction and multi-asset investment management.
  • Previous experience in a CIO, Deputy CIO, or senior portfolio management role within an asset manager, family office, sovereign wealth fund, or institutional investment platform.
  • Strong understanding of global markets, macro strategy, and risk management.
  • Demonstrated leadership experience managing investment teams and committees.
  • Excellent stakeholder management and communication skills.
